S3 DRIVES ADOPTION OF NEXT-GENERATION MEMORY TECHNOLOGY

DDR SDRAM Provides Up to a 3x Increase in Memory Performance

SANTA CLARA, Calif., April 7 /PRNewswire/ -- Establishing a foundation
for future multimedia performance advancements, S3(R) Incorporated
(Nasdaq: SIII) announced today that it has joined with other industry
leaders to drive the standardization of Double Data Rate (DDR) SDRAM
memory technology for the mainstream PC industry. Providing up to a 3x
increase over today's memory technologies, DDR SDRAM will extend the
capabilities of currently used synchronous memory to enable
significantly higher levels of performance for tomorrow's PC users.

"Based on existing synchronous memory architectures, DDR SDRAM provides
the PC industry with a virtually painless way of achieving significant
performance increases, said Neal Margulis, senior vice president of
Research & Technology for S3 Incorporated. "Just as S3 was
instrumental in migrating the PC platform from Fast Page to EDO DRAM,
S3 will work with other industry leaders to drive the adoption of DDR
SDRAM as the memory technology of choice for next-generation mainstream
PC designs."

S3 -- the first multimedia acceleration company to participate in the
review and definition of the DDR SDRAM specification -- is currently
working with both the SDRAM II Forum and the Joint Electron Device
Engineering Council (JEDEC) to finalize industry acceptance of DDR
SDRAM memory technology. On Thursday of last week, S3 hosted a meeting
of the SDRAM II Forum at its headquarters in Santa Clara (CA) to
finalize the DDR SDRAM specification. On Friday, S3 hosted a meeting
with the JEDEC Solid State Memories subcommittee to initiate
ratification of the proposed specification.
